A Diverse Collection Reflecting a Shared Heritage
The exhibition boasted a truly impressive turnout, featuring artworks from over 165 artists hailing from Kuwait, other Gulf countries, and various parts of the Arab world. This selection wasn’t limited to a single style or medium. Instead, the variety of paintings and artistic creations was deliberately curated to inspire audiences and broaden their artistic horizons.
This impressive showing of contemporary art proves the growing artistic movement within the region. It’s a movement that is not only embracing traditional techniques but also experimenting with innovative approaches and exploring relevant social themes. The broad representation also fostered a sense of collective identity; the art, though diverse in execution, spoke to a shared cultural history and regional concerns.
